Land Scandal Forces Singer Zaaki Azzay to Resign as PMAN 2nd Vice President

Nigerian singer and entertainer Zaaki Azzay has officially resigned from his role as the Performing Musicians Employers’ Association of Nigeria (PMAN) 2nd Vice President amid controversy surrounding an alleged land scandal. The development has sparked widespread discussions across the Nigerian music industry and among fans of the veteran singer.

Zaaki Azzay, known for his distinct style and contributions to Afrocentric music, announced his decision to step down after pressure mounted over the scandal, which reportedly involved disputes over land ownership and allegations of misconduct. While the details remain under investigation, his resignation marks a major shake-up in PMAN’s leadership structure.

Industry observers believe Zaaki’s exit could have ripple effects on the union, especially given his active involvement in initiatives geared toward artist welfare, creative rights, and youth empowerment. His resignation comes at a time when PMAN has been working on reforms to strengthen its influence and credibility within the Nigerian entertainment industry.

Fans and colleagues in the music space have expressed mixed reactions, with some praising Zaaki Azzay for taking responsibility while others lament the potential setback his resignation may cause in ongoing industry projects.

For now, the spotlight remains firmly on PMAN as the association moves to fill the leadership vacuum left behind, while many wait to see how Zaaki Azzay will navigate the controversy and his career going forward.
